Overview

  • This individual works within the team of Data & IT Operations that owns and performs all support activities to large set of applications. A team player who takes up below responsibilities:
Responsibilities

• Ensures daily and monthly operational processes run successfully.• Resolves incidents for issues arise in production processes with relevant urgency.• Escalates incidents and assign appropriate Priority levels.• Works with offshore contractors in all support activities. Coordinates shift times with onsite & offshore team as required part of job.• Effecitvely communicates with data consumers on potential SLA impacts due to production failures.• Track and complete Problem tickets from incidents. Work with Incident and Problem management teams. Perform root cause analysis (RCA) of the issues.• Proactively identifies operational inefficiencies and works on solutions. Work with data consumer teams and development team to design solutions to increase operational efficiencies.• Monitors applications level controls and reconciliations.• Participates in Audits to demonstrate data movements are meeting the defined rules and standards.• Identifies creative, technology-based opportunities to improve service levels and reduce costs with solution teams and data consumers.• The individual participates in Disaster Recovery, ACLC activities. Represents applications under the organization to complete required tasks.• Will demonstrate the understanding of concepts of ITIL/ITSM best practices on IT operations.• Works on BAU activities that require working on development tasks. This requires working with development team at some capacity to manage the work load within the organization.• Becomes part of a large team spread across different geographical locations, working at different timezones.• Manages offshore coordination.• Trains in required toolset to perform job functions.• Works on periodic infrastructure and technology upgrades of the tools in use.• Adheres to architecture, design methodologies and best practices in support and development. Qualifications

• 5+ years of experience in Data Management and Business Intelligence with a minimum of 3 years in supporting IT & Data operations- technology.• 5+ years or relevant technology development and IT operations experience • Strong analytical and critical thinking skills, issue resolution skills, with ability to understand inter-dependencies of multiple information systems.• Working experience in the area of Business Intelligence and Analytics, with special focus on supporting data movement, Data Hubs, Data Marts, Data Warehouse and Data Virtualization environments.• Strong problem solving skill with the ability to analyze and break down a problem to identify root cause.• Strong background and working experience in IT Service Management (ITSM certification preferred).• SQL-MS SQL Server 2014 or later, Oracle 12g, ETL-SSIS, Data Stage, SSRS, SSAS, Data Virtualization (Denodo), Python, Java, .Net Skills• Strong communication skills.• Experience in Financial industry.• Experianced working with teams location across different timezones and geographical locations.• Bachelor's degree. Preferably in Computer Science, Mathematics, Engineering or related field.

Highly preferable knowledge in:• Domain knowledge in any areas of Loan, Lease, Treasury, Factoring, Risk and Banking (Mortgage, Deposits etc.)• Data Governance concepts and application on Data management support activities.• BI and reporting tools: Tableu, Business Objects, Power BI, OBIEE, SSRS, Qlik
